Arkansas Coach Bret Bielema and Hope junior defensive end McTelvin Agim continued to build on their relationship during Agim’s latest visit on Saturday.

“He just let me know he wanted me here,” Agim said. “He wanted me to enjoy the time I was there. Just normal coach B. He was still cool.”

Agim, 6-3, 265, 4.59 seconds in the 40-yard dash, is one of the best prospects in the nation at his position and has scholarship offers from Arkansas, Alabama, Auburn, Baylor, Stanford, Clemson, Oklahoma and others to prove it. Video highlights CLICK HERE

Bielema joked about Agim’s ever changing body that's packed on about 20 pounds since last year.

“He tried to talk about me a little bit,” Agim said. “He tried to talk about my clothes like my pants. He said he could see that I’m working because my body is growing and my pants get smaller. He was trying to play with me.”

Sebastian Tretola, Jared Cornelius, Dan Skipper, Hunter Henry, Jonathan Williams and other players took questions from Agim and seven other recruits.

“Someone asked the biggest transaction from high school to college and they were like time management,” Agim said.

The current Razorbacks also encouraged the prospects to embrace their senior year.

“They were like enjoy it more,” Agim said. “They said they enjoy Fayetteville, but some people are like ‘an I’m ready to get to college. They said just enjoy being a kid and living with your parents.”

Agim is rated a 4-star plus prospect by national recruiting analyst Tom Lemming of CBS Sports Network. He has recorded a 345 pound bench press, 335 power clean, 315 incline and 530 squat.

The Hogs are high on Agim’s list.

“I’m high on Arkansas right now,” he said. “I’m liking the area and the fans, the coaches. Everything. I’m just liking Fayetteville.
